The Scholars Program

Urgency: Low

Scholars Program offers a full-tuition scholarship for students planning to attend one of three prestigious Arizona universities. The scholarship covers tuition, fees, room, and board for four years and includes mentorship and enrichment activities. The deadline to apply is March 1, 2027.

FAQ

What does The Thunderbirds Scholars Program cover?
The scholarship covers full tuition, fees, room, and board for four years, along with mentorship and support for study abroad and internships.
Who is eligible for The Thunderbirds Scholars Program?
Arizona high school graduates with a minimum GPA of 3.5 who plan to attend Arizona State University, University of Arizona, or Northern Arizona University.
When is the application deadline for The Thunderbirds Scholars Program?
The application deadline is March 1, 2027.
Can the scholarship be combined with other funds?
The scholarship cannot be combined with other funds, except for needs-based federal financial aid.
